UW talks out of both sides of its mouth on conscience rights
The Alliance Defense Fund (ADF) today published a letter sent to the UW Medical Foundation on behalf of several employees of the Madison Surgery Center (MSC). The employees are concerned they may be compelled to participate in the MSC’s late-term abortion plan. The letter questions a memo sent by Peter Christman of the UW Medical Foundation to all MSC employees, declaring that employees would be expected to assist in “emergencies resulting from” the late-term abortions.
The ADF points out that Christman’s declaration, if made a MSC policy, would violate both federal and state laws protecting the conscience rights of medical professionals, as well as contradict the public statements of the UW Hospital & Clinics. One UW statement insists, “No physicians, residents, students or staff will be required to participate in any aspect of this procedure if it is against their personal beliefs. Participation is strictly voluntary.” (emphasis added)
Peggy Hamill, State Director of Pro-Life Wisconsin, offered the following comments:
“The UW is talking out of both sides of its mouth when it comes to respecting the lawful conscience rights of its pro-life medical professionals. The MSC abortions are not emergencies – they are elective, planned and scheduled. But the late-term abortions do have serious risks. The UW seems to want to do these dangerous abortions without getting willing staff to protect mothers. Instead they are threatening to randomly yank in unwilling personnel to clean up their messes. It appears the MSC cannot find enough willing staff, or worse, they’re trying to cut costs.”
“The UWHC Authority Board’s public vote on February 4 to go forward with the MSC late-term abortion plan was made contingent upon providing enough willing staff to cover complications from an inherently dangerous surgical procedure. Now we find a UW employee skirting the Board’s directive. Put simply, the UW cannot be trusted in this entire matter. Their obfuscations and ambiguities are growing tiresome, and we call on them to abandon this inhuman endeavor once and for all.”
